I'd be pretty down if my boyfriend was always with his friends too and he had no time for me. Yeah, it's great to be able to hangout with your friends, but you do need time to hangout with your girlfriend/boyfriend, too. I understand where you are coming from. I think you really need to talk to him about this. If you don't talk about it, you'll never be able to solve this problem.


Explain to him that it's alright that he's close with his friends and you understand it when he needs some 'guy time' with his buddies. Tell him that it shouldn't always be about them and there should be some days where it's JUST you; not his friends. Tell him that it annoys you when you want to have a day for you and him and he wants to bring his friends along. A date is with you and your girlfriend/boyfriend, not with his friends and you. You both DO need alone time with one another. Try to make him understand that. Talk to him about whatever is on your mind, explain it all. ♥
